So I just discovered CG a few days ago and decided I should try it. I have 2B hair that very thin and obnoxiously frizzy. It takes a long time to dry and it absorbs product like crazy. I'll put massive amounts of mousse or gel and it doesn't feel like there's a drop of anything in my hair. The top most layer gets frizzy as do my ends, and the underside of my hair barely has a wave to it. I think a lot of my frizz comes from the fact that I wear my hair in a ponytail for most of the year for baton practice and competitions.

I kept posting all over the boards about my frizz problem until I discovered, my hair is protein thirsty! Once I discovered this, my frizz reduced big time.

My idea of mixing Braggs Amino Acids into my conditioner and then doing a deep treatment transitioned into me putting this stuff in my conditioner everyday. I keep waiting to see if my hair protein ODs.
